Myths About Hair Transplantation

Hair transplantation is often misunderstood, and there are many myths surrounding the procedure. Here, we’ll explore some common myths and separate fact from fiction.

Myth #1: Hair Transplantation is Painful

Many people believe that hair transplants are extremely painful. However, the procedure is performed under local anesthesia, meaning you won’t feel pain during the surgery. Post-procedure discomfort is usually minimal and can be managed with pain relievers.

Myth #2: Transplanted Hair Doesn’t Look Natural

With modern techniques like FUE and DHI, transplanted hair looks completely natural. The hair follicles are implanted carefully and blend seamlessly with your existing hair, resulting in a fuller and more natural appearance.

Myth #3: The Results Are Immediate

While some initial hair growth can be seen within a few months, the full results of a hair transplant typically take 12 to 18 months to appear. The process of hair regrowth occurs in stages, and patience is required for optimal results.

Conclusion

Hair transplantation is a safe and effective procedure when done by a qualified professional. By understanding the myths and facts, you can make a more informed decision about the treatment.
